Overview: Train from Glasgow to Capenhurst
Trains from Glasgow to Capenhurst run on average 4 times per day, taking around 4h 16m. Cheap train tickets for this journey start at £156 if you book in advance.
The earliest train runs at 06:12, the last at 17:32. The fastest train covers the 302 km distance in 3h 44m.
